Installing the WHMCS Module

Introduction

To complete installation of The SSL Store™’s WHMCS Module, you will first need to download the module from the WHMCS Integration page within your partner account at The SSL Store™. Once you’ve downloaded the module, please proceed with unzipping the download and the contents so you have the “modules” folder unzipped.

File Uploading

  1. Now that you’ve successfully extracted the download, you will want to connect via FTP to your server.

Note: Uncertain which FTP Client to use? The SSL Store™ recommends FileZilla due to the compatibility across all operating systems.

  1. Once connected, proceed to the directory housing your WHMCS Installation.
  2. Within the directory listing, locate the “modules” folder and click the folder so you see a list of folders, specifically the “addons” and “servers” folders.
  3. First proceed into the addons folder and copy the folder “thesslstorefullv2_admin” from the downloaded package so the files begin to upload.
  4. Upon completion of the upload, proceed back to the “modules” directory and then into the “servers” directory.
  5. Drag the folder “thesslstorefullv2” over so that the files begin uploading.
  6. After completion of the upload, proceed to your WHMCS Admin Login page.

WHMCS Configuration

Note: The typical URL path for the Administrator interface is “/admin/”, but this could have been changed. Please ensure that you proceed to the proper URL as configured.

  1. At this point, you should proceed to login to your WHMCS System using a login that has the role of “Full Administrator” so they can properly configure the module.
  2. Once logged in, proceed to the “Setup -> Addon Modules” page so you can continue to set up the module.
  3. At the bottom of that page, there will be an option of “The SSL Store™ Module” with the options of “Activate”, “Deactivate” and “ The last two will be disabled for now.
  1. Click the “Activate” button, which will begin the installation of the module.
  2. Upon receiving the confirmation “Addon Module Activated,” scroll to the bottom once more and click the “Configure” button.
  3. Clicking the “Configure” button will display a permissions menu for your WHMCS System. Proceed with selecting which groups you would like to be able to access The SSL Store™ Module and click “Save Changes”.
  4. At this point, you’re all set up and ready to start configuring! To proceed with the setup process, go to the menu “Addons -> The SSL Store™ Module”.
